1. Nourish Your Body
A healthy body paves the way for healthy hair growth, including facial hair. Make sure you are getting enough essential nutrients and vitamins. Incorporate a balanced diet rich in proteins, vitamins A, B, C, and E, as well as minerals such as zinc and magnesium, which directly contribute to hair growth.
2. Stay Hydrated
Proper hydration is key to overall health and beard growth. Drink plenty of water daily to keep your body and hair adequately hydrated. Water helps stimulate hair follicles and promotes hair growth, so make it a habit to drink at least 8 glasses of water a day.
3. Don’t Skip Exercise
Engaging in regular physical activity not only benefits your body but can also boost beard growth. Exercise improves blood circulation, promoting the delivery of essential nutrients to your hair follicles. A healthy circulation ensures optimal beard growth, so incorporate exercise into your routine for better results.
4. Get Enough Sleep
Sleep is crucial for your body’s overall well-being and indirectly affects beard growth. Lack of sleep can lead to hormonal imbalances, which can slow down facial hair growth. Aim for 7-8 hours of quality sleep each night to allow your body to restore itself optimally.
5. Keep Stress at Bay
Stress can adversely affect many aspects of our lives, including beard growth. High-stress levels can disrupt hormone production, leading to reduced facial hair growth. Find healthy ways to manage stress, such as meditation, exercise, or hobbies, to encourage better beard growth.
6. Practice Proper Beard Care
Caring for your existing facial hair is just as important as promoting new growth. Follow these essential beard care tips:
- Regularly wash your beard with a mild beard shampoo to keep it clean and healthy.
- Apply a beard conditioner or beard oil to moisturize and soften the hair, reducing the risk of breakage.
- Brush or comb your beard daily to distribute its natural oils and stimulate growth.
- Trim your beard regularly to remove split ends and encourage healthier growth.
- Avoid excessive heat styling or using harsh chemicals on your beard, as they can damage the hair shafts.
7. Be Patient
Remember, beard growth takes time and patience. Avoid comparing your growth rate to others, as each person’s genetics and biology are unique. Embrace and celebrate your beard journey, knowing that with proper care and a healthy lifestyle, your beard will achieve its full potential.
